Understanding Global Liquidity Trends
Recent statements from the Federal Reserve, notably by Minneapolis Fed President Neel Kashkari, suggest a readiness to inject more liquidity into the market. This pivot comes against the backdrop of rising concerns in the bond market, primarily driven by increased bond sell-offs by China, which has significantly altered interest rates across the board. The inverse relationship between bond prices and interest rates indicates that when bonds are sold off en masse, their prices drop, causing yields to rise, which in turn affects market stability.
Moreover, inflation data shows a promising downward trend, with recent Consumer Price Index (CPI) figures coming in lower than expected – signaling that inflationary pressures may be easing. From a peak of over 9% in 2022, inflation appears to be stabilizing around the Fed's target of 2%. This shift allows the Fed to contemplate liquidity injections without exacerbating inflation, thus creating a more favorable environment for asset values, including cryptocurrencies.
The Impact on Ethereum
As global liquidity begins to rise, Ethereum’s price dynamics reflect a potential shift back into an upward trajectory. Historically, Ethereum's performance has been closely linked to liquidity conditions; increases in global liquidity have correlated positively with Ethereum’s market share against Bitcoin. Conversely, tightening liquidity has often caused Ethereum to lose ground, a trend observed since late 2022. Recent technical analysis shows Ethereum has transitioned beyond previous resistance levels, breaking above its 100-day exponential moving average (EMA) and signifying a bullish pattern. This momentum suggests that ETH could be ripe for recovery, paralleling the broader market's optimistic shifts driven by macroeconomic conditions.
